Fire department access is not just for the building but
other events that take place on the Property. The new ambulance height
is 11’ 3 inches, The back parking lot shall have a minimum vertical
clearance of 12 feet. This will prevent any of our heavy vehicles from
entering the area and still allow our EMS crews access.
My other concern is with the fire hydrant on the current site plan.
Its just a matter of how it is facing, currently it puts the firefighter
in the path of traffic while getting it hook up. I don’t see this as a
major issue as there looks to be enough room to turn it. The better
scenario is to have the parking space to the north stripe off which
would give us a better working area. Understanding that there are
always issues with the number of parking spaces I would not ask for that
unless we have and excessive amount. If there are ant other questions

Asst Chief Cunningham –
A couple quick question on your review comments.
No. 1 – FIRE ACCESS ROUTE
Please refer to the attached pdf that depicts the fire access route
circumnavigating the entire building.
Will the fire access route as shown suffice for your approval?
We have a structural challenge with the slab over the underground
stormwater system and need to restrict the last 3 rows of parking to
passenger vehicles.
Access to the enclosed dumpster is still adequate for your fire trucks
and has been approved by Dan Robson at Waste Pro for solid waste
collection.
No. 2 - FRONT FIRE HYDRANT LOCATION
Please refer to the attached pdf that is an enlargement of the
utilities at the front of the building.
Would appreciate clarification on the location / direction of the FH.
We placed the FH adjoining 2 exit lanes onto A1A, and setback from A1A
active travel-way by the turnlane; also close to the DDCV and Siamese
connection; in addition, the onsite pavement in this area is 36’+ due to
the canopy drive-thru.
